I’m having the same thing with ‘seeing’ (ie being reminded of) faces in patterns too - it’s called pareidolia and I’m yet to meet someone who has never experience it. :) Since we are anxious, our mind is constantly on the lookout for ‘danger’ and the ‘danger’ for you are facial patterns.
